4-core enhancement


When you first learn this enhancement, choose one of the six ability scores: Strength, Dexterity, Constitution, Intelligence, Wisdom, or Charisma. While a creature wears or wields this object, its corresponding ability score becomes 19 if it would otherwise be lower. A Constitution-equalizing item doesn't affect maximum heart points, but can still affect heart points restored from short rests and other such effects.
